Description

Even for newly licensed salespersons, the business of real estate carries risk. In residential real estate transactions, you’re responsible for assisting clients in one of the largest purchases of their lives. Clients risk hundreds of thousands of dollars or more. With so much on the line, they rely on your expertise to help them make well-informed decisions. In addition, people invest not just their money in a real estate purchase; they invest their emotions and their family’s well-being in these transactions. When things go wrong, they look to their real estate representative as the cause first.  The scope of risk can cover a variety of areas. Within Virginia Post-Licensing: Risk Management course, we examine the risks involved in property disclosures, licensing, agency, contracts, antitrust, and fair housing. In addition, we look at how to manage these risks in comparison to the potential rewards you can achieve.

Instructors

Meet your instructor, Tara Furges Houston! Tara is the Founder and CEO of Houston Consulting Group & Associates, LLC, a consulting practice with a mission of helping others build their legacies. She practices real estate with EXP Realty as a global real estate advisor (Former State Managing Broker) in DC and MD and (Former Compliance Broker) in VA. Alongside her husband, Michael, she serves as a leader and ambassador for the brokerage. Tara and Michael train, mentor, and coach their personal agent group (Legacy Builders Global of eXp Realty), consisting of over 220 REALTORS (spanning nine different states) to build successful real estate businesses.

The 2019 President of Women’s Council NOVA Metro, Tara has co-authored two books – The Confident Woman (chapter titled “Eagles Don’t Need Parachutes”) and Overcoming the Good Little Girl Syndrome (chapter titled “Saying No without Guilt”).  Before becoming a full-time entrepreneur, Tara served as an educator for over 21 years in teacher, Principal, and college professor roles.  She has documented success in using creative teaching methods to ensure participants leave her classes and workshops energized and empowered with knowledge. Tara teaches Broker and Salesperson Pre-licensing and CE courses for DC, MD, and VA. A life-long learner, she has the At Home with Diversity (AHWD), Certified Luxury Home Marketing Specialist (CLHMS), Certified International Property Specialist (CIPS), and Professional Management Network (PMN) designations.
